制定一份学习python的学习计划
时间: 2023-10-26 14:41:07 浏览: 64
学习 Python 可以遵循以下学习计划:
1. 先了解基本的编程概念和语法,例如变量、数据类型、条件语句、循环语句和函数等。可以通过阅读 Python 的官方文档或相关书籍来学习。
2. 熟悉 Python 的标准库,学习如何使用内置函数和模块,例如 os、sys、math 等。这些库可以让你在编写代码时更加高效和便捷。
3. 学习面向对象编程,包括类和对象、继承和多态等。这是 Python 的重要特性,也是很多复杂程序的必备技能。
4. 学习数据结构和算法,例如列表、字典、栈、队列、排序和查找等。这些知识可以帮助你更好地理解 Python 的内置数据类型,并提高你的编程能力。
5. 尝试用 Python 解决实际问题,例如爬虫、数据分析、机器学习等。这可以帮助你将所学知识应用到实际中,提高你的编程技能和实践经验。
6. 加入 Python 相关的社区和论坛,例如 Python 中文社区、Stack Overflow 等。这些平台可以让你更好地了解 Python 的最新动态和技术发展,同时也可以得到其他 Python 程序员的帮助和建议。
相关问题
制定一份详细的python学习计划
以下是一份详细的Python学习计划:
1. Python基础知识
- 了解Python的历史和发展
- 安装Python解释器
- 学习Python的基本语法、变量、数据类型、运算符、控制流程等基础知识
- 掌握Python的函数、模块、包、异常处理等高级特性
- 学习Python的面向对象编程(OOP)概念、类、继承、多态等知识点
2. Python库和框架
- 学习Python的标准库和第三方库,如NumPy、SciPy、pandas、matplotlib等
- 了解Python的Web框架,如Django、Flask等
- 掌握Python的爬虫框架,如Scrapy等
- 学习Python的机器学习和深度学习库,如TensorFlow、Keras等
3. 数据分析和可视化
- 学习如何使用Python进行数据分析和可视化,包括数据清洗、转换、处理、分析和可视化
- 掌握Python的数据分析工具,如pandas、NumPy等
- 学习Python的可视化工具,如matplotlib、Seaborn等
4. 实战项目
- 学习如何使用Python完成实际项目,如数据分析、机器学习、Web开发等
- 了解如何使用Python进行数据挖掘和机器学习,包括数据预处理、特征提取、模型训练和评估等
- 学习如何使用Python开发Web应用,包括前端和后端的开发
5. 社区和资源
- 加入Python社区,参与开源项目和技术交流
- 掌握如何使用Python的文档、教程、书籍、博客等资源,不断更新自己的知识和技能
总之,Python的学习需要不断地积累和实践,只有不断地实践和思考,才能真正掌握Python的精髓。
帮我制定一份python爬虫学习计划
很高兴为你制定一份python爬虫学习计划,建议你首先搞清楚什么是爬虫,它的作用,以及如何使用它。然后,你可以学习python的基本语法,以及如何使用python来编写爬虫程序。接下来,学习一些python爬虫框架,比如scrapy、beautifulsoup等,并尝试编写一些简单的爬虫程序。最后,学习一些高级爬虫技术,比如如何绕过反爬虫机制,如何处理动态网页等。